Person Directory Operations - Create Dynamic Person Group
Crea un nuovo gruppo di persone dinamiche con dynamicPersonGroupId, nome e utente specificato dall'utenteData.
Un gruppo di persone dinamiche è un contenitore che fa riferimento alla directory person "Create Person". Dopo la creazione, usare la directory delle persone "Aggiorna gruppo di persone dinamiche" per aggiungere/rimuovere persone da/verso il gruppo di persone dinamiche.
I dati dinamici di Person Group e utente verranno archiviati nel server finché non viene chiamato "Delete Dynamic Person Group" (Elimina gruppo di persone dinamiche). Usare "Identify From Dynamic Person Group" con il parametro dynamicPersonGroupId per identificare le persone.
Nessuna immagine verrà archiviata. Solo le caratteristiche del viso estratte e userData verranno archiviate nel server fino a quando non viene chiamato "Delete Person" o "Delete Person Face".
'recognitionModel' non deve essere specificato con i gruppi di persone dinamici. I gruppi di persone dinamici sono riferimenti alla directory delle persone "Crea persona" e quindi funzionano con la maggior parte di tutti i "recognitionModel". Il faceId specificato durante "Identificare" determina il "recognitionModel" usato.
PUT {endpoint}/face/{apiVersion}/dynamicpersongroups/{dynamicPersonGroupId}
Parametri dell'URI
Nome | In | Necessario | Tipo | Descrizione |
---|---|---|---|---|
api
|
path | True |
string |
Versione API |
dynamic
|
path | True |
string |
ID del gruppo di persone dinamiche. Criterio di espressione regolare: |
endpoint
|
path | True |
string uri |
Endpoint di Servizi cognitivi supportati (protocollo e nome host, ad esempio: https://{nome-risorsa}.cognitiveservices.azure.com). |
Corpo della richiesta
Nome | Necessario | Tipo | Descrizione |
---|---|---|---|
name | True |
string |
Il nome definito dall'utente, la lunghezza massima è 128. |
userData |
string |
Dati facoltativi definiti dall'utente. La lunghezza non deve superare 16.000. |
Risposte
Nome | Tipo | Descrizione |
---|---|---|
200 OK |
La richiesta ha avuto esito positivo. |
|
Other Status Codes |
Risposta di errore imprevista. Intestazioni x-ms-error-code: string |
Sicurezza
Ocp-Apim-Subscription-Key
Chiave privata per la sottoscrizione di Viso di Intelligenza artificiale di Azure.
Tipo:
apiKey
In:
header
AADToken
Flusso OAuth2 di Azure Active Directory
Tipo:
oauth2
Flow:
accessCode
URL di autorizzazione:
https://api.example.com/oauth2/authorize
URL token:
https://api.example.com/oauth2/token
Ambiti
Nome | Descrizione |
---|---|
https://cognitiveservices.azure.com/.default |
Esempio
Create DynamicPersonGroup
Esempio di richiesta
PUT {endpoint}/face/v1.2-preview.1/dynamicpersongroups/your_dynamic_person_group_id
{
"name": "your_dynamic_person_group_name",
"userData": "your_user_data"
}
Risposta di esempio
Definizioni
Nome | Descrizione |
---|---|
Face |
Oggetto error. Per informazioni dettagliate sui codici di errore e i messaggi restituiti dal servizio Viso, vedere il collegamento seguente: https://aka.ms/face-error-codes-and-messages. |
Face |
Risposta contenente i dettagli dell'errore. |
FaceError
Oggetto error. Per informazioni dettagliate sui codici di errore e i messaggi restituiti dal servizio Viso, vedere il collegamento seguente: https://aka.ms/face-error-codes-and-messages.
Nome | Tipo | Descrizione |
---|---|---|
code |
string |
Uno di un set definito dal server di codici di errore. |
message |
string |
Rappresentazione leggibile dell'errore. |
FaceErrorResponse
Risposta contenente i dettagli dell'errore.
Nome | Tipo | Descrizione |
---|---|---|
error |
Oggetto error. |